PR firm Paver Smith’s Manchester win

PR AGENCY Paver Smith will help to deliver a social marketing campaign across Greater Manchester after winning a four-way pitch.

The campaign by Greater Manchester Public Health Network, aims to tackle ill-health through offering free medical checks and lifestyle advice.

Paver Smith is designing a website, leaflets, posters, giveaways and the livery for a “health check bus”.

Managing partner Jon Brown said: “It’s great to be working on a project which will hopefully make a real difference to people’s lives and it’s encouraging, as an agency, to continue to win business in Greater Manchester against fierce competition.”

Edna Boampong, head of communications for Greater Manchester Public Health Network, said: “We tested Paver Smith’s design concepts across a range of focus groups and it was clear they would achieve our aims in terms of communicating some key messages to communities most at risk of illness through poor lifestyle choices.”
